Insurance Seminar Series 2012: Part 3 – Directors and Officers (D&O) Liability Insurance.
The third seminar of our Insurance Seminar Series focuses on Directors and officers and for those in this position the need to be more vigilant in carrying out their duties and obligations in light of recent Court decisions which change director accountabilities. In addition, directors may be caught in the crossfire of increasing surveillance of companies by regulatory authorities.
All directors need to understand the recent changes to the legal framework and to work out how they may need to change their practices and behaviour going forward in order to address these potential risks including considering how to obtain and maximise protection from liability and legal claims under a D&O Insurance Policy.
TressCox Financial Services and Corporate Risk Partner Michael Bracken, Senior Associate Sarah Wheeler and Associate Levina Chim will be presenting.
The seminar will cover:
- An introductory overview of the scope of a D&O Insurance Policy;
- Recent court decisions and changes in the law relating to directors;
- Implications for D&O cover and negotiating coverage.
